The standard ruler

A. Description of a standard ruler

The standard ruler is a basic measuring tool used for various purposes in everyday life, education, and professional fields. It is typically made of wood, plastic, or metal and has a rectangular shape with a straight edge. Standard rulers come in various lengths, but the most common length is 12 inches.

B. Divisions on a standard ruler

A standard ruler is divided into smaller units of measurement to provide precise measurements. The most prominent divisions on a standard ruler are inches, centimeters, and millimeters, each of which has its own scale. These divisions are marked by small lines and numbers along the length of the ruler.

The inches division is the primary unit of measurement on a standard ruler, and it is further divided into smaller increments such as half-inches, quarter-inches, eighths of an inch, sixteenths of an inch, and even smaller units like thirty-seconds and sixty-fourths of an inch.

In addition to inches, a standard ruler also includes a centimeter scale on one side and a millimeter scale on the other side. This allows for easy conversion between different units of measurement.

# Inches

## Definition of an inch
An inch is a unit of length commonly used in the United States, United Kingdom, and other parts of the world. It is equal to 1/12th of a foot or approximately 2.54 centimeters.

## Historical background of the inch
The inch has a long history dating back to ancient times. The word “inch” is derived from the Latin word “uncia,” which means one twelfth. It was originally defined as the width of an adult thumb, but over time, various standardized measurements were adopted.

In the 18th century, the British government established the Imperial system in which the inch was defined as exactly 25.4 millimeters. This definition was later adopted by the United States after the American Colonies gained independence.

A. Definition of a centimeter

A centimeter is a unit of measurement in the metric system used to measure length. It is equal to one hundredth of a meter and is commonly abbreviated as “cm”.

B. Relationship between inches and centimeters

Understanding the relationship between inches and centimeters is essential when working with measurements in different systems. One inch is equal to 2.54 centimeters, which means that there are approximately 2.54 centimeters in one inch.

The use of centimeters is widespread in many countries and fields, especially in scientific and mathematical applications. It provides a more precise and standardized way of measuring length compared to inches.

When using a ruler that includes centimeter markings, each centimeter is divided into smaller subdivisions, usually millimeters. This allows for more precise measurements using the metric system.

For example, if you are measuring an object with a ruler that includes both inch and centimeter markings, you can use the centimeter markings to obtain a more accurate measurement.

Converting measurements between inches and centimeters is relatively straightforward. To convert inches to centimeters, simply multiply the number of inches by 2.54. To convert centimeters to inches, divide the number of centimeters by 2.54.

Millimeters

Definition of a millimeter

A millimeter is a unit of measurement in the metric system, specifically used to measure small lengths or distances. It is known as a millimeter because it is equal to one thousandth of a meter. The millimeter is represented by the symbol “mm”.

Relationship between inches and millimeters

Understanding the relationship between inches and millimeters is essential in accurately measuring objects using a ruler. One inch is equal to 25.4 millimeters. This conversion factor allows you to convert measurements from inches to millimeters and vice versa.

While inches are commonly used in the United States and other countries following the Imperial system, millimeters are widely used in metric countries. Therefore, it is important to be able to convert between the two systems when necessary.

Identifying millimeters on a ruler

Most standard rulers have markings in both inches and millimeters. Millimeters are typically represented by smaller divisions spaced closer together than the larger inch markings. Each millimeter is marked with a short line, and every fifth millimeter is usually labeled with a slightly longer line.

To measure using millimeters, align the object with the nearest millimeter marking on the ruler. If the object falls between two millimeter markings, estimate the measurement by comparing the position of the object with the lines on the ruler. The more accurate the estimation, the more precise the measurement will be.

**Sample conversion table**

Below is a sample conversion table that demonstrates the conversion between inches, centimeters, and millimeters:

| Inches | Centimeters | Millimeters |
|——–|————-|————-|
| 1 | 2.54 | 25.4 |
| 2 | 5.08 | 50.8 |
| 3 | 7.62 | 76.2 |
| 4 | 10.16 | 101.6 |
| 5 | 12.7 | 127 |
| 6 | 15.24 | 152.4 |

This table demonstrates how inches can be converted to both centimeters and millimeters. For example, if a ruler measures 3 inches, it is equivalent to 7.62 centimeters or 76.2 millimeters. Similarly, 5 inches is equal to 12.7 centimeters or 127 millimeters.

Eighths of an Inch

A. Explanation of Eighths of an Inch

Eighths of an inch are one of the smaller divisions on a ruler and are commonly used in precise measurements. As the name suggests, one inch is divided into eight equal parts. Each part represents 1/8th of an inch. This means that each 1/8th of an inch measures approximately 0.125 inches.

Understanding eighths of an inch is crucial when it comes to accurate measurements, especially in fields such as construction, engineering, and woodworking. The use of eighths of an inch allows for precise measurements, ensuring the correct fit or alignment of materials.

B. Identifying Eighths of an Inch on a Ruler

Identifying eighths of an inch on a ruler is relatively simple, as they are clearly marked between every inch. On a standard ruler, the inch marks are typically highlighted with longer lines, while the eighths of an inch marks are denoted by shorter lines.

To locate a specific measurement in eighths of an inch, start by identifying the nearest inch. Each inch is divided into two halves, which are then divided into four quarters, and finally into eight eighths. The eighths are marked by small lines between the larger lines that represent the halves and quarters.

How to measure using a ruler

A. Step-by-step guide on measuring in inches

To effectively measure using a ruler, follow the steps below:

1. Gather the necessary materials: Grab a ruler with clear markings and a clean surface to place the object you wish to measure.

2. Line up the zero mark: Place the zero end of the ruler flush against one end of the object you want to measure. Ensure that the ruler is straight and not tilted.

3. Read the measurement: Look closely at the markings on the ruler and locate the line that aligns with the other end of the object. The number on the ruler that lines up with the end of the object is the measurement in inches.

4. Account for fractions: If the object extends past a line and reaches a division between two lines, this signifies a fraction of an inch. Identify which fraction it falls under by counting the smaller lines between the whole number markings.
